GTA 6 Leaker Has ‘Cashed Out’ And Reportedly Earned Around $270,000, Fans Believe

Analysis of overnight cryptocurrency transactions points to the prolific GTA 6 leaker having “cashed out” of their meme coin, earning around $270,000 in the process.

That’s according to reliable GTA watcher and crypto analyst Vice Cit, who previously posted evidence that strongly suggested the leaking antics of “Cyberleek” were part of a cryptocurrency scheme, rather than their claimed excuse of it being a protest against the death of physical media.

Every video posted by the person or persons known as Cyberleek has pointed to a website where fans could pay to vote on further leaks using the leaker’s own cryptocurrency. These leaks have since increased in frequency over the past few days, and also escalated in terms of the content they showed — revealing full frontal nudity in one recent video, and then finally beginning to spoil the game’s story in the latest clip posted to date.

The rapid release of more leaks, as well as Rockstar’s own impending official reveal of gameplay footage via Netflix, suggested to some fans that Cyberleek was getting ready to make their move and earn whatever money they could before interest waned and their currency inevitably collapsed.

Indeed, this now appears to be the case, with Cyberleek apparently pocketing all the currency’s trading fees and transferring them into at least two other sources overnight, ready for withdrawal. Vice Cit has a detailed log of where the money went, up to a point, but not enough to help identify who was actually behind it all. The fact that multiple withdrawal methods were allegedly used could point to multiple people being behind Cyberleek, Vice Cit speculated, though this cannot be confirmed.

Whether the culprit or culprits are ever caught now seems to rely on how successful Rockstar’s legal team and the relevant law authorities are at forcing social networks or crypto exchanges to divulge any personal details they hold on those responsible.

“The original setup of this whole project (the CYBERLEEK token, the website, and the file uploads) was around $29,000 at the time of my first investigation,” Vice Cit wrote. “Which means the person or group behind this leak profited around $241,000 if this is where this all ends. Not an amount to completely dismiss but is it really ‘risk your freedom money’?

“I personally believe the leaker expected to make much more from this project and the watermark messaging in the most recent clips feels kind of panicky. As the coin continued to drop over the last 24 hours and the public started to lose interest I believe the leaker made the choice to cash out.”

And then there’s the million dollar (or $241,000) question: are the GTA 6 leaks over? There’s no reason why Cyberleek couldn’t release more footage, and no suggestion they were close to getting caught. Indeed, it would be the ultimate test of Cyberleek actually caring about their stated cause of physical media if they continued posting even now. Time will tell, though at the time of writing Rockstar is now just hours from taking center stage.
